I have experienced a lot of things but the most difficult situation I had in my life was when my father divorced my mother. From it I learned I have to study hard in order to help myself and also my family. When I performed well in my form four examinations, I felt proud of myself. I was so happy because I felt like all my dreams were near me. The happiest thing in my life is my mother's happiness. When my mom is happy, I feel like the world is going good by my side.
The dream of my life is to be a professional engineer and to get there I will study hard. After reaching my dreams I will make sure I provide all the things my family needs back to the world education fund community. I will make sure I provide any support they need. If I had power in my country, I would like to change the education system.

Dr Grace Lordan suggest ‘’Take small steps and build the future that you want’’ and here are 10 lessons from her beautiful work ‘’THINK BIG’’.

10 lessons from
" THINK BIG "📚
-
1. Don't be afraid to dream big. The first step to achieving anything is to believe that it's possible. So don't be afraid to dream big, even if your dreams seem impossible.

2. Set goals and make a plan. Once you know what you want, it's time to create a plan for how you're going to achieve it. Break your goals down into smaller, more manageable steps, and then make a schedule for when you're going to complete each step.

3. Take action. The most important thing is to take action. Don't just sit around and dream about what you want to achieve. Take steps every day to move closer to your goals.

4. Don't give up. There will be times when you want to give up. But if you keep going, you will eventually achieve your goals.

5. Be patient. It takes time to achieve anything worthwhile. So be patient and don't expect to see results overnight.

6. Surround yourself with positive people. The people you spend time with have a big impact on your success. So surround yourself with positive people who will support you and help you achieve your goals.

7. Believe in yourself. The most important thing is to believe in yourself. If you believe that you can achieve your goals, then you're halfway there.

8. Never stop learning. The world is constantly changing, so it's important to keep learning new things. The more you learn, the better equipped you'll be to achieve your goals.

9. Don't be afraid to fail. Everyone fails at some point. But don't let failure discourage you. Learn from your mistakes and keep moving forward.

10. Enjoy the journey. Don't just focus on the end goal. Enjoy the journey of achieving your goals. It's a journey that will teach you a lot about yourself and help you grow as a person.

I hope these lessons help you on your journey to achieving your dream and having a better experience running towards your dreams and goals.
